I had a root canal and now my tooth has gone dark and it is painful, what should I do?

Q.
Hello Dr Butt,
I had a root canal on my front tooth some couple of years ago,but unfortunately,i keep having pains from time to time and the tooth is becoming darker.kindly advice me on what to do and also how much it will cost me.
Thanks.
A.
Root canal does not guarantee you are not going to have a problem . It is a treatment of last resort to prevent the tooth from being taken out once the tooth is damaged. The procedure involves removal of the nerve tissue and bacteria from the tooth canal and filling the space.as the mouth is not sterile there will be some bacteria trapped in the tooth. Sometimes the dentist cannot fill the tooth completely due to obstruction. Hence you can still have problems, especially when your immune system is run down.
The darkness is due to lack of blood and nerve supply which was removed during the root canal.
My advice get an opinion on if the root canal can be redone better to get rid of the pain. If it can then once done think about bleaching the tooth or a crown
